Output f577e36d5b12ea1085006e6fb567e45e88c763f4a337b70c2204acaa3abe5cc8:1

value
680000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f32be1f11b0974c87ad38afb8a8b3cd987251f91 OP_EQUAL
address
AEc3S27ZC129DysLVVxuxFTtrJmjkCN6BL
transaction
f577e36d5b12ea1085006e6fb567e45e88c763f4a337b70c2204acaa3abe5cc8